## About the Role

We are looking for a talented and motivated Software/Algorithm Engineer to join our team. In this role, you will develop and implement advanced image analysis algorithms applied to full wafer metrology data, enabling high-precision characterization and process control in semiconductor manufacturing.

## Key Responsibilities

- Design, develop, and validate image analysis algorithms for full wafer metrology data processing

- Analyze large-scale spatial metrology datasets to extract actionable process insights

- Collaborate with hardware and process engineers to define algorithm requirements and integrate solutions into measurement workflows

- Develop and maintain robust, well-tested software modules in a production engineering environment

- Benchmark algorithm performance and drive continuous improvements in accuracy, speed, and reliability

- Document technical approaches, results, and design decisions clearly

## Required Qualifications

- MS+ in Physics, Optical Engineering, Electrical Engineering, Applied Mathematics, or a related field

- Strong foundation in optical physics

- Expertise in wave-optics modeling and physics-based simulation of optical measurement systems

- Strong foundation in image processing and computer vision algorithms

- High proficiency in one or more of the following: Python, MATLAB and C/C++

- Experience with scientific computing libraries

- Strong analytical and problem-solving skills

## Preferred Qualifications

- Experience with semiconductor metrology, inspection, or process control data

- Familiarity with high-sensitivity camera models and their characteristics, including noise profiles, dynamic range, and readout modes

- Experience with machine learning or statistical modeling applied to engineering data

- Knowledge of data visualization tools and best practices

- Experience working in an iterative development environment

Who We Are

Applied Materials is a global leader in materials engineering solutions used to produce virtually every new chip and advanced display in the world. We design, build and service cutting-edge equipment that helps our customers manufacture display and semiconductor chips – the brains of devices we use every day. As the foundation of the global electronics industry, Applied enables the exciting technologies that literally connect our world – like AI and IoT.
